Rosindale Man Charged in Drug Case

Jeremy Stephen Harrelson (BCSO)

Bladen narcotics investigators arrested a man for selling a variety of illegal drugs and possessing an illegal shotgun  Aug. 7.

Jeremy Stephen Harrelson, 49, was charged with six counts of possessionwith intent to manufacture, sell and deliver Methamphetamine, marijuana, psilocybin mushrooms, and benzodiazepines; maintaining a dwelling for drug activities, and possession of a weapon of mass destruction. His address was listed as 214 Rosindale Road, Clarkton on court records. He was held under $100,000 secured bond.

The Bladen Sheriff’s Office said the arrest was the result of an extensive undercover investigation into drug sales in the Lisbon area. Harrelson was identified as an alleged dealer, and sold drugs to an informant, the BCSO said.

When investigators executed a search warrant on. His home, they found a wide variety of illegal drugs, two handguns, and a sawed-off shotgun.
